Generally, there are two situations when doing IUD removal surgery. One is if you want to get pregnant again, and the other is that women in menopause must have it removed. If it is not removed, it will have a very big impact on your health. Before removing the IUD, you should pay attention to the fact that choosing the right time to remove it is very important. It is best to do it three to seven days after the menstruation is over, so that there will be less bleeding caused by the IUD removal operation. Six to twelve months after menopause is the best time. If it is removed too early, it may cause pregnancy. If it is removed too late, the uterus will shrink, so it will increase the difficulty of removing the IUD. Before removing the IUD, you need to do an X-ray or B-ultrasound examination. If the IUD has a tail thread, the doctor also needs to observe whether there is a nylon thread outside the uterine opening at the vaginal opening. After the diagnosis is confirmed, the IUD can be removed. IUD removal is a minor operation, so it is not very dangerous. In addition, a comprehensive examination is also required for IUD removal.IUD removal is a surgical procedure that involves removing the contraceptive ring placed in the patient's uterine cavity through artificial surgery. It is mainly suitable for women who need to have a baby again after having an IUD inserted, women whose IUD is about to expire after the IUD insertion surgery, and women who have entered menopause. Many women who decide to have an IUD removal surgery for the first time are most concerned about its risks before the operation. Generally speaking, there is a certain risk in removing an IUD, especially for female friends who miss the expiration date of the IUD after it is inserted and do not remove it. The risk of removing the IUD will be even greater.Therefore, in order to reduce the risk of IUD removal surgery as much as possible, female friends should pay attention to the best time to remove the IUD when deciding to remove it. In addition, you must go to a professional, regular obstetrics and gynecology hospital to remove the contraceptive ring, which will be safer. |
